Are Tyrrells Sweet Chilli & Red Pepper Crisps Vegan?

Tyrrells Sweet Chilli & Red Pepper Crisps may be vegan.

Tyrrells Sweet Chilli & Red Pepper Crisps may be vegan, but we’re not certain. Let me explain:

Tyrrells Sweet Chilli & Red Pepper Crisps is labelled as vegetarian only on the Tyrrells website and according to most supermarkets. However, all of the ingredients seem to be vegan-friendly.

Soooooo… Are Tyrrells Sweet Chilli & Red Pepper Crisps vegan or not?

The ingredients in Tyrrells Sweet Chilli & Red Pepper Crisps seem to vegan-friendly. However, nowadays, brands will label their products vegan when they are. The fact that Tyrrells haven’t labelled the product as vegan, could be a concern.

While the ingredients are vegan, we can’t be sure that the production process is vegan. Sometimes, animal products are used to process certain products, which you won’t find in the ingredient list.

It could also be that because there may have been cross-contamination with non-vegan products in the factory, Tyrrells are being strict with their labelling. The packaging does say the product may contain milk.

Ingredients: Potatoes, Sunflower Oil, Sugar, Salt, Yeast Extract, Onion Powder, Tomato Powder, Ground Spices (Cayenne Pepper, White Pepper, Jalapeno Pepper, Ginger, Star Anise), Garlic Powder, Dried Herbs (Parsley, Basil), Colour (Paprika Extract), Dried Red Bell Pepper
